P1352

Description
BY-PASS CIRCUIT OPEN

The Ignition Control Module (ICM) sends signals that PCM
requires for fuel control and spark advance calculations. At start of
engine crank, ICM controls spark advance (by-pass mode). When the
second 3X reference pulse is recognized by the PCM, PCM applies 5
volts to by-pass circuit, commanding ICM to switch spark advance to
PCM control (IC mode). If PCM detects an open in the IC circuit, DTC
will set. Engine will start and may run in by-pass mode timing.

Symptoms
You likely won't notice any drivability problems.

Causes

  • PCM detects an open in by-pass circuit.
